|  | package java.io; | 
|  |  | 
|  | import gnu.java.nio.channels.FileChannelImpl; | 
|  |  | 
|  | import java.nio.channels.ByteChannel; | 
|  | import java.nio.channels.FileChannel; | 
|  |  | 
|  | /** | 
|  | * This class represents an opaque file handle as a Java class.  It should | 
|  | * be used only to pass to other methods that expect an object of this | 
|  | * type.  No system specific information can be obtained from this object. | 
|  | * | 
|  | * @author Aaron M. Renn (arenn@urbanophile.com) | 
|  | * @author Tom Tromey (tromey@cygnus.com) | 
|  | * @date September 24, 1998 | 
|  | */ | 
|  | public final class FileDescriptor | 
|  | { | 
|  | /** | 
|  | * A <code>FileDescriptor</code> representing the system standard input | 
|  | * stream.  This will usually be accessed through the | 
|  | * <code>System.in</code>variable. | 
|  | */ | 
|  | public static final FileDescriptor in | 
|  | = new FileDescriptor (FileChannelImpl.in); | 
|  |  | 
|  | /** | 
|  | * A <code>FileDescriptor</code> representing the system standard output | 
|  | * stream.  This will usually be accessed through the | 
|  | * <code>System.out</code>variable. | 
|  | */ | 
|  | public static final FileDescriptor out | 
|  | = new FileDescriptor (FileChannelImpl.out); | 
|  |  | 
|  | /** | 
|  | * A <code>FileDescriptor</code> representing the system standard error | 
|  | * stream.  This will usually be accessed through the | 
|  | * <code>System.err</code>variable. | 
|  | */ | 
|  | public static final FileDescriptor err | 
|  | = new FileDescriptor (FileChannelImpl.err); | 
|  |  | 
|  | final ByteChannel channel; | 
|  |  | 
|  | /** | 
|  | * This method is used to initialize an invalid FileDescriptor object. | 
|  | */ | 
|  | public FileDescriptor() | 
|  | { | 
|  | channel = null; | 
|  | } | 
|  |  | 
|  | /** | 
|  | * This method is used to initialize a FileDescriptor object. | 
|  | */ | 
|  | FileDescriptor(ByteChannel channel) | 
|  | { | 
|  | this.channel = channel; | 
|  | } | 
|  |  | 
|  |  | 
|  | /** | 
|  | * This method forces all data that has not yet been physically written to | 
|  | * the underlying storage medium associated with this | 
|  | * <code>FileDescriptor</code> | 
|  | * to be written out.  This method will not return until all data has | 
|  | * been fully written to the underlying device.  If the device does not | 
|  | * support this functionality or if an error occurs, then an exception | 
|  | * will be thrown. | 
|  | */ | 
|  | public void sync () throws SyncFailedException | 
|  | { | 
|  | if (channel instanceof FileChannel) | 
|  | { | 
|  | try | 
|  | { | 
|  | ((FileChannel) channel).force(true); | 
|  | } | 
|  | catch (IOException ex) | 
|  | { | 
|  | if (ex instanceof SyncFailedException) | 
|  | throw (SyncFailedException) ex; | 
|  | else | 
|  | throw new SyncFailedException(ex.toString()); | 
|  | } | 
|  | } | 
|  | } | 
|  |  | 
|  | /** | 
|  | * This methods tests whether or not this object represents a valid open | 
|  | * native file handle. | 
|  | * | 
|  | * @return <code>true</code> if this object represents a valid | 
|  | * native file handle, <code>false</code> otherwise | 
|  | */ | 
|  | public boolean valid () | 
|  | { | 
|  | return channel != null && channel.isOpen(); | 
|  | } | 
|  | } |
